2025 Red Sox Season Begins Today
So, the 2025 Red Sox begins today. They will begin the start of the season in Texas with the team playing the Texas Rangers for a 4 game series.
So, the 2025 Red Sox begins today. They will begin the start of the season in Texas with the team playing the Texas Rangers for a 4 game series.